Role Summary

The 3rd Shift Production Associate is an integral part of the Manufacturing team based in Omaha, NE, responsible for assisting in multiple aspects of the trace mineral production process to ensure efficient operations and product quality. The role involves ingredient handling, equipment setup and testing, operation of material handling equipment, and maintaining cleanliness in the production area. Safety-conscious, detail-oriented candidates committed to high standards of quality and performance are ideal.

Responsibilities

  • Add the appropriate ingredient and amount to the designated hand add station according to batching software instructions.
  • Operate bag and/or tote packaging equipment.
  • Replenish ingredient delivery systems.
  • Prepare sampling materials for quality control purposes.
  • Operate forklift to facilitate the movement of materials required for production.
  • Inspect, set up, and test equipment including scales, load cells, and magnets.
  • Perform housekeeping and general cleaning duties to ensure plant and employee safety.
  • Take personal responsibility for the safety and quality of assigned tasks.
  • Work effectively as part of a high-performance team to achieve production goals.
